What Is a Categorical Syllogism?
A categorical syllogism is a type of logical argument that uses statements about categories or groups to reach a conclusion. Each statement typically relates one category to another using terms like all, some, or no.
Basic Structure
A standard categorical syllogism has three parts
- Major premise a general statement about a category
- Minor premise a statement about a specific case or subset
- a logical result based on the premises
Example
All humans are mortal. Socrates is a human. Therefore, Socrates is mortal.
Classification of Categorical Syllogisms
Categorical syllogisms can be classified in different ways depending on structure, validity, and form. Understanding these classifications helps in analyzing arguments more effectively.
1. Based on Figure
The figure of a categorical syllogism refers to the position of the middle term in the premises. There are four main figures.
First Figure
In the first figure, the middle term is the subject of the major premise and the predicate of the minor premise.
- Major premise All M are P
- Minor premise All S are M
- All S are P
This is considered the most natural and commonly used structure in logical reasoning.
Second Figure
In the second figure, the middle term is the predicate in both premises.
- Major premise No P are M
- Minor premise All S are M
- No S are P
This figure is often used to show exclusion between categories.
Third Figure
In the third figure, the middle term is the subject in both premises.
- Major premise All M are P
- Minor premise Some M are S
- Some S are P
This structure often leads to conclusions about partial membership.
Fourth Figure
In the fourth figure, the middle term appears as predicate in the major premise and subject in the minor premise.
- Major premise All P are M
- Minor premise All M are S
- Some S are P (in some valid forms)
This figure is less commonly used in everyday reasoning.
Based on Mood of Categorical Syllogism
The mood of a syllogism refers to the types of categorical statements used. There are four standard forms of categorical propositions
Types of Propositions
- A Universal affirmative (All S are P)
- E Universal negative (No S are P)
- I Particular affirmative (Some S are P)
- O Particular negative (Some S are not P)
Example of Mood
A syllogism with the form AAA uses three universal affirmative statements, while EIO uses a mix of negative and particular statements.
Valid and Invalid Categorical Syllogisms
Not all categorical syllogisms are logically valid. Validity depends on whether the conclusion logically follows from the premises.
Valid Syllogism
If the structure guarantees that the conclusion must be true when the premises are true, the syllogism is valid.
Invalid Syllogism
If the conclusion does not logically follow, even if the premises seem true, the syllogism is invalid.
Common Rules of Validity
There are several rules used to test the validity of categorical syllogisms.
Rule 1 Three Terms Only
A valid syllogism must contain exactly three terms major, minor, and middle.
Rule 2 The Middle Term Must Be Distributed
The middle term must be fully represented at least once in the premises.
Rule 3 No Conclusion from Two Negative Premises
If both premises are negative, no valid conclusion can be drawn.
Rule 4 Affirmative Conclusion Requires Affirmative Premises
A valid affirmative conclusion cannot come from negative premises.

Examples of Categorical Syllogisms
Understanding examples makes it easier to grasp different kinds of syllogisms.
Example 1 (First Figure)
All birds are animals. All sparrows are birds. Therefore, all sparrows are animals.
Example 2 (Second Figure)
No cats are dogs. All pets in this house are dogs. Therefore, no pets in this house are cats.
Example 3 (Third Figure)
All dogs are mammals. Some dogs are pets. Therefore, some pets are mammals.
Common Errors in Categorical Syllogisms
Logical mistakes often occur when constructing syllogisms.
Undistributed Middle
This happens when the middle term is not properly used in the premises.
Illicit Major or Minor
This occurs when a term is distributed in the conclusion but not in the premises.
Affirmative Conclusion from Negative Premises
This is a violation of basic logical rules.
